The Glass Spider was an huge outing, even for Bowie’s superstar status. The stage was covered with the body of a huge you-guessed-it. It was in fact named the largest touring set-up ever. At the beginning, David was lowered from the top of it.

Bowie saw it as a theatrical outing. There was spoken word, he had the newest thing: video visuals, a dancing troupe and of course a hell of a band, led by schoolmate Peter Frampton. He did 86 shows in total and made 86 million dollars of it. Many artists later said that their big shows were inspired by this first extravaganza.
